    I won't vote either since I love both albums.

    The guy sitting in the doorway is actually Bill Kreutzmann drummer for the Dead. Lyricist Robert Hunter is actually standing next to Garcia on one end of the group. He was at one time considered a "member" of the band even though he generally only wrote lyrics for Garcia tunes (although in the early days of the band he seemed to write most of the lyrics regardless).
